CITY OF CARMEL-BY-THE-SEA, CALIFORNIA REQUEST FOR PROPOSALS RFP #23-24-007 PROFFESIONAL COASTAL ENGINEERING AND ENVIRONMENTAL SERVICES FOR CARMEL BEACH COASTAL PROTECTION AND ACCESS IMPROVEMENTS PROJECTS Notice is hereby given that the City of Carmel-by-the-Sea (City) is soliciting proposals from qualified coastal engineering consultants to enter into a Professional Services Agreement with the City for condition assessments, environmental permitting, and engineering design of a multi-phased project to repair damaged shoreline infrastructure along the iconic Carmel Beach, as follows: Wood Stairs – Existing Conditions Survey . Perform existing condition surveys of foundations, structural members, hardware, etc. at six wooden beach access stairs off of Scenic Road (ST1 @ Martin Way, ST4 @ Twelfth Avenue, ST6 @ Tenth Ave South, ST7 @ Tenth Avenue North, ST8 @ Ninth Avenue, and ST11 @ Fourth Avenue, west of San Antonio Avenue). Prioritize repairs and prepare cost estimates. Stairs ST4 and ST7 Repair Project - Prepare engineering plans, technical specifications, Engineer's Estimates, and acquire Environmental Permits for the repair of structurally-damaged and closed to the public stairways at Twelfth Avenue and Tenth Avenue North. A goal of this project is to reopen these beach access stairs as soon as possible. Coastal Protection and Access Improvements Program. Expand upon condition assessment information generated in the 2023 Carmel Beach Coastal Protection Assessment Report for the subsequent repair of other beach access stairways (both wood and concrete), all six revetment structures, and ten seawalls. Identify all regulatory permits and approvals required for each repair, prioritize repairs, and prepare cost estimates. The report will form the basis for a multi-year capital improvement program to make these repairs. Seawall S10 Replacement Project . Prepare design plans, technical specifications, Engineer's Estimates, and acquire all environmental permits needed for the reconstruction of Seawall S10, which includes a drainage outfall, between Ocean and Fourth Avenues.
